背景信息

ZFHX1B, also known as Zinc Finger Homeobox 1B, is a transcription factor that belongs to the homeobox gene family, playing a critical role in development and cellular processes. It is characterized by its zinc-finger motifs and homeodomain, which facilitate DNA binding and interaction with other transcriptional regulators. Research into ZFHX1B has gained prominence due to its association with various developmental disorders, particularly the 18q deletion syndrome, which is characterized by cognitive impairment, growth deficiencies, and congenital malformations. Understanding the molecular mechanisms and pathways regulated by ZFHX1B is essential for elucidating its role in normal development and disease pathogenesis. Additionally, studies have indicated that ZFHX1B may be involved in cancer progression, highlighting its potential as a therapeutic target. The recombinant protein form of ZFHX1B is particularly valuable for investigations into its functional characteristics, interaction with other proteins, and regulatory networks. By producing ZFHX1B as a recombinant protein, researchers can conduct in vitro assays to determine its DNA-binding capabilities and its influence on gene expression. Overall, the study of ZFHX1B recombinant protein is crucial for advancing our understanding of its biological functions and implications in human health and disease.
